add missing -ldl to lua.pc

When I updated my existing buildroot configuration to 2017.05 or newer I get
build errors in the package "swupdate":

  Trying libraries: pthread lua m z ubootenv
  Failed: -Wl,--start-group -lpthread -llua -lm -lz -lubootenv -Wl,--end-group
  ...
  ==========
  .../output/host/arm-buildroot-linux-gnueabihf/sysroot/lib/liblua.so:
undefined reference to `dlopen'
  .../output/host/arm-buildroot-linux-gnueabihf/sysroot/lib/liblua.so:
undefined reference to `dlclose'
  .../output/host/arm-buildroot-linux-gnueabihf/sysroot/lib/liblua.so:
undefined reference to `dlerror'
  .../output/host/arm-buildroot-linux-gnueabihf/sysroot/lib/liblua.so:
undefined reference to `dlsym'
  coll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
  make[1]: *** [swupdate_unstripped] Error 1

The root cause is a missing "-ldl" in etc/lua.pc.

This is probably wrong for all lua patches that add etc/lua.pc, although I
personally only tested lua-5.3.4. The patch should apply to them too.

I'm attaching the patch that I added to my buildroot external directory to fix
the build problem.
